A massive blaze has reduced a multi-million dollar mansion in Rockwall, Texas to rubble, leaving behind only charred remains of what was once a luxury home.

The fire erupted early Thursday morning at a sprawling residence located at 1460 Anna Cade Road, completely destroying the property that was valued at approximately $2.5 million. Local fire departments responded to the scene, but were unable to save the structure as flames had already engulfed significant portions of the home by the time crews arrived.

What caused such a devastating fire? Authorities haven’t yet released official information about the origin of the blaze, though investigators were seen combing through the debris later in the day.

The residence, situated in one of Rockwall’s more affluent neighborhoods, represented a substantial loss not just in monetary terms but likely in personal possessions and memories for its owners. No immediate reports of injuries have emerged from the incident, suggesting the home may have been unoccupied when the fire started.
